I need help writing a regex for a phone number pattern that allows the following formats for a phone number

1)###-###-####
or 
2)#-###-###-####
or
3)###-####
or
4)##########
or
5)#######

I am well aware, that you are able to find regex patterns on the internet, but I havent been able to find one that will pass for all these patterns.

I am using Java
